Top - Ranked Hospitals in New York City
According to U.S. News & World Report, several hospitals in New York City have achieved high rankings. These hospitals offer a wide range of medical services and are often at the forefront of medical innovation. Here are some of the top - ranked hospitals:
- NYU Langone Hospitals: Nationally ranked in 13 specialties and 3 children's specialties. It is also “high performing” for 21 procedures and conditions, including cancer treatments. The hospital is committed to providing comprehensive and personalized care.
- New York - Presbyterian Hospital - Columbia and Cornell: This hospital is nationally ranked in 14 adult specialties and 10 pediatric specialties. It is included in the honor roll list and ranked “high performing” in one adult specialty and 20 procedures and conditions.
- Mount Sinai Hospital: Ranked the best hospital in the state. It is included in the U.S. News & Health Reports’ honor roll, nationally ranked in 12 adult specialties and four children specialties, and received “high performing” acknowledgments for 20 procedures. It ranked #1 in the nation in geriatrics care.
- North Shore University Hospital at Northwell Health: Nationally ranked in 9 specialties and performed highly in 15 procedures and conditions. One of the national rankings is being the 10th best orthopedic hospital.
- Lenox Hill Hospital at Northwell Health: Nationally ranked in 10 adult specialties, including being ranked #16 in the nation for obstetrics and gynecology. The hospital also has 17 “high performance” ratings.
Departments and Specialties Relevant to Nasal Tip Correction
Otolaryngology - Head & Neck Surgery
Otolaryngology - Head & Neck Surgery departments in New York City hospitals are at the forefront of treating various head and neck conditions, including nasal issues. These departments are staffed with experts who have in - depth knowledge of the anatomy and physiology of the nose and are well - equipped to perform nasal tip correction procedures.
For example, NYU Langone’s otolaryngology - head & neck surgery department takes a patient - centered approach to treatment. Their team of otolaryngologists, also known as ear, nose, and throat specialists, and head and neck surgeons are dedicated to providing the best care for adults and children. The department is also actively involved in research and clinical trials to enhance care for ear, nose, and throat conditions. U.S. News & World Report’s “Best Hospitals” ranks NYU Langone among the top 10 hospitals in the nation for ear, nose, and throat.

The Role of U.S. News & World Report Rankings
U.S. News & World Report's hospital rankings are based on a comprehensive evaluation of various factors. These factors include clinical outcomes, level of nursing care, patient experience, and research capabilities. Preparing for Nasal Tip Correction
If you are considering nasal tip correction in New York City, it is important to prepare yourself both physically and mentally. Here are some steps you can take:
- Research hospitals and departments: Use the hospital rankings and other resources to identify the best hospitals and departments for your needs. Read patient reviews and talk to people who have had similar procedures.
- Consult with a surgeon: Schedule a consultation with a qualified surgeon. During the consultation, ask questions about the procedure, the expected outcomes, and the potential risks. The surgeon will also evaluate your nasal anatomy and determine the best approach for you.
- Follow pre - operative instructions: The surgeon will provide you with pre - operative instructions, which may include avoiding certain medications, quitting smoking, and following a specific diet. It is important to follow these instructions carefully to ensure a successful procedure.
Recovery and Aftercare
Recovery after nasal tip correction is an important phase. Here are some key points to keep in mind:
- Follow post - operative instructions: The surgeon will provide you with post - operative instructions, which may include taking medications, keeping the nose clean, and avoiding strenuous activities. Following these instructions is crucial for a smooth recovery.
- Attend follow - up appointments: Regular follow - up appointments with the surgeon are necessary to monitor your recovery and ensure that everything is healing properly. The surgeon may make adjustments to your treatment plan if needed.
- Manage expectations: It takes time for the swelling to go down and for the final results of the nasal tip correction to become apparent. It is important to be patient and manage your expectations during the recovery process.
